Getting Started with Pet Photography
Starting in pet photography https://joy-casinosloty.com/ doesn’t require a huge investment. A good DSLR or mirrorless camera, a fast lens (like a 50mm f/1.8), and plenty of patience are your most important tools. Natural light works well, especially outdoors or near https://vdcasino886.com/ windows. Studio setups can be used for more stylized shoots, but many clients prefer lifestyle photos that feel authentic and candid.
The key to a great pet https://ukgamescasino.com/ photo isn’t perfect technique—it’s capturing expression and emotion. Pets can be unpredictable, so it’s essential to stay flexible and work with their energy. Let them play, explore, and interact with their environment. Candid shots often turn out more powerful than posed ones.
Editing and Sharing
Editing pet photos typically involves http://casino-advice.com/ enhancing colors, softening backgrounds, and sometimes removing distractions. Lightroom is ideal for basic adjustments, while Photoshop can help with more detailed retouching (like leash removal or background cleanup).
Sharing your work online is critical for growth. Build a pet-specific portfolio or Instagram page to showcase your style. Use hashtags like #petphotographer, #dogsofinstagram, or #catphotography to reach relevant audiences. Consistency in tone and presentation helps you attract both fans and potential clients.
Working with Clients and Pets
When working professionally, communication with pet owners is essential. Discuss the pet’s personality, favorite toys, energy levels, and any specific shots the client wants. Sessions should be relaxed and playful, giving the animal time to warm up to the camera and environment.
Offering themed shoots (e.g., holiday sessions, birthday portraits, or “puppy’s first year” packages) can make your services stand out. Many pet photographers also partner with groomers, vets, or pet stores for cross-promotion.
